Understanding Strut Mounts on the 2016 Nissan Pulsar
The 2016 Nissan Pulsar is a popular hatchback in Australia, known for its reliability and smooth drive. When it comes to the suspension system, the Pulsar employs a MacPherson strut setup at the front. This means strut mounts are not only relevant but essential components in the vehicle's front suspension assembly.
Strut mounts are the connecting points between the suspension struts and the car's chassis. On the 2016 Nissan Pulsar, these mounts serve several important functions that often go unnoticed by the average driver but are crucial to ride quality, steering response, and vehicle safety.
Basically, strut mounts do three main things. First, they secure the strut assembly firmly to the body of the car. Second, they act as a pivot point for the steering system, allowing the wheels to turn smoothly. Third, many strut mounts incorporate a rubber or elastomeric component that helps absorb road vibrations and isolates noise, making your drive more comfortable. On the Pulsar, these mounts are typically designed with a bearing integrated into the mount, allowing the top of the strut to rotate as the wheels turn.
Over time, strut mounts can wear out. This is especially true in Australian conditions where heat, dust, and rough roads can take their toll. When a strut mount begins to fail, drivers might notice increased noise coming from the front suspension, like clunking or creaking sounds over bumps. Steering can also feel less crisp, sometimes accompanied by a slight vibration felt through the steering wheel. If neglected, worn strut mounts can cause uneven tyre wear or even affect vehicle alignment, leading to further issues down the track.
When it comes to maintaining your 2016 Nissan Pulsar, keeping an eye on the condition of the strut mounts is quite important. While they might not need frequent replacement like brake pads or air filters, they do require inspection during regular suspension servicing or when replacing the struts themselves. Since the strut mounts are integral to the strut assembly, many mechanics recommend replacing the mounts whenever the struts are changed. This helps ensure the entire system is functioning optimally and avoids having to dismantle suspension components again shortly afterward.
Here are a few tips related to strut mounts and maintaining the front suspension of a Nissan Pulsar:
- Always inspect the strut mounts during suspension servicing or tyre changes. Look for cracks in the rubber, excessive movement, or noise when turning the wheels.
- If you hear unusual noises from the front end, such as clunks, creaks, or squeaks during steering or over bumps, it's worth getting the strut mounts checked.
- Replacing strut mounts in pairs (both sides of the front suspension) is a good practice. It maintains suspension balance and consistent handling.
- Use genuine Nissan replacement parts or high-quality aftermarket mounts designed specifically for the 2016 Nissan Pulsar to ensure proper fit and durability.
- Strut mount replacement can be a labour-intensive job requiring the strut to be compressed and removed. It's recommended to have this service performed by a qualified mechanic with the right tools.
Proper maintenance and timely replacement of strut mounts improve the Pulsar's handling characteristics and comfort, making driving safer and more enjoyable. Worn mounts can also lead to added strain on other suspension components, potentially increasing repair costs if left unchecked.
In everyday driving, especially on Aussie roads where potholes and uneven surfaces are common, the ability of the strut mounts to cushion shocks and reduce road noise is hugely beneficial. When they perform well, drivers often notice a quieter cabin and more responsive steering.
